## Route notes

This is an ultra-long-haul route, one of the longest in aviation. It requires wide-body aircraft with extended range capability such as the Airbus A350-900ULR or Boeing 777-200LR. Passengers should prepare for an extended flight with multiple meal services.

Time-zone information: When it's 17:24 in Gagnoa, it's 07:24 in Honolulu.
With a 10-hour time difference, expect significant jet lag.
